Pierre Gasly warns AlphaTauri that Yuki Tsunoda needs ‘more self-control'

Yuki Tsunoda initially struggled in Formula 1 after signing for AlphaTauri at the beginning of 2021. The Japanese driver was seen by fans to have an uncontrollable temper and when combined with his tendency to crash his car, it looked like Tsunoda would not last long in the sport. It has been suggested that the 22-year-old simply needed time to adapt to life in Formula 1, especially having moved from Japan with his family to living in Milton Keynes by himself. Tsunoda has improved tenfold since his rocky start with AlphaTauri, and has formed a strong bond with the Alpine-bound Pierre Gasly, similar to how Carlos Sainz took Lando Norris under his wing during their time together at McLaren....
